A vulnerability classified as problematic has been found in libgit2 up to 0.24.2. Affected is the function git_commit_message
of the file oid.c of the component Object File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a out-of-bounds v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-125. The product reads data past the end, or before the beginning, of the intended buffer. This is going to have an impact on availability. CVE summarizes:
The git_commit_message function in oid.c in libgit2 before 0.24.3 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) via a cat-file command with a crafted object file.
The bug was discovered 10/08/2016. The weakness was shared 02/03/2017 by Gustavo Grieco (Website). The advisory is available at lists.opensuse.org. This vulnerability is traded as CVE-2016-8568 since 10/08/2016.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ploitation doesn't require any form of authentication. Technical details are known, but there is no available exploit.
The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 65 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$0-$5k.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 95756 (openSUSE Security Update : libgit2 (openSUSE-2016-1450)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family SuSE Local Security Checks and running in the context l.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 169590 (OpenSuSE Security Update for libgit2 (openSUSE-SU-2016:3097-1)).
Upgrading to version 0.24.3 e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published even before and not after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
